About Yohei Takeda
Yohei Takeda is a scholar working on Gastroenterology, Oncology and Pulmonary and Respiratory Medicine, having authored 56 papers that have together received 537 indexed citations. Recurring topics across this work include Pancreatic and Hepatic Oncology Research (20 papers), Gallbladder and Bile Duct Disorders (17 papers) and Pancreatitis Pathology and Treatment (8 papers). The work is most often cited by research in Gastroenterology (43 citations), Hepatology (54 citations) and Oncology (180 citations). Yohei Takeda has collaborated with scholars based in Japan, United Kingdom and Indonesia. Frequent co-authors include Kazuya Matsumoto, Hajime Isomoto, Takumi Onoyama, Soichiro Kawata, B. Adkins, Taro Yamashita, Hiroki Koda, Hiroki Kurumi, Kazuo Yashima and Shigeo Morimoto. Their work appears in journals such as Journal of Clinical Oncology, SHILAP Revista de lepidopterología and Gastroenterology.
